This is a replica of a sailing ship that won many races. It sails daily out of Lunenburg, Nova Scotia.
Bluenose was launched at Lunenburg, Nova Scotia on March 26, 1921, as a racing ship and fishing vessel. This was in response to the defeat of the Nova Scotian Fishing Schooner Delawana by the Gloucester fishing schooner Esperanto in 1920. During the next 17 years of racing, no challenger, American or Canadian, could wrest the International Fishermen's Trophy from her.
